the mean of all the sample means obtained from all random samples of a certain sample size in a sampling distribution is an example of a biased statistic. true or false

Answers

The mean of all the sample means obtained from all random samples of a certain sample size in a sampling distribution is an example of a biased statistic is False.

sampling distribution:


The mean of all the sample means obtained from all random samples of a certain sample size in a sampling distribution is an example of an unbiased statistic. This is because the sampling distribution of the mean is centered at the true population mean, and the mean of all sample means provides an estimate of that true population mean without any systematic over- or under-estimation.

However, individual sample means can be biased if there are any issues with the sampling process or if the sample is not representative of the population.

a newsletter publisher believes that 78% of their readers own a rolls royce. is there sufficient evidence at the 0.02 level to refute the publisher's claim? state the null and alternative hypotheses for the above scenario.

Answers

There is not enough information provided to determine if there is sufficient evidence at the 0.02 level to refute the publisher's claim. The null hypothesis is that proportion of readers owning a Rolls Royce is equal to 0.78 and alternative hypothesis is that proportion of readers owning a Rolls Royce is not equal to 0.78.

To determine if there is sufficient evidence at the 0.02 level to refute the newsletter publisher's claim that 78% of their readers own a Rolls Royce, we need to conduct a hypothesis test. Here are the null and alternative hypotheses for this scenario:

Null Hypothesis (H0): The proportion of readers who own a Rolls Royce is equal to 0.78 (P = 0.78)

Alternative Hypothesis (H1): The proportion of readers who own a Rolls Royce is not equal to 0.78 (P ≠ 0.78)

To test these hypotheses, follow these steps:

1. Collect a random sample of readers and record the number of Rolls Royce owners in the sample.

2. Calculate the sample proportion (p-hat) of Rolls Royce owners.

3. Calculate the test statistic using the formula: z = (p-hat - P) / sqrt(P * (1-P) / n), where P is the claimed proportion (0.78) and n is the sample size.

4. Determine the critical value for a two-tailed test at the 0.02 significance level (α = 0.02), which is approximately ±2.576 (from a z-table or calculator).

5. Compare the test statistic (z) to the critical value. If the test statistic is greater than or equal to the critical value or less than or equal to the negative critical value, reject the null hypothesis in favor of the alternative hypothesis. If not, fail to reject the null hypothesis.

Based on the results, you can determine if there is sufficient evidence to refute the publisher's claim at the 0.02 significance level. What is 0.55 hectometers expressed in decimeters?a.550 dmb.5.5 dmc.55 dmd.0.00055 dmwhat is 0.55 hectometers expressed in decimeters? a.550 dmb.5.5 dmc.55 dmd.0.00055 dm brainly

Answers

The value of 0.55 hectometers expressed in decimeters is 550 decimeters. The result is obtained by using the concept of unit ladder system.

How the unit ladder method works?

The common length units are kilometers to milimeter. The conversion can be described in a unit ladder system as follows.

km (kilometers)

  hm (hectometers)

     dam (decameters)

        m (meters)

           dm (decimeters)

              cm (centimeters)

                  mm (millimeters)

Every time the length unit goes down, it is multiplied by ten. Every time the length unit goes up, it is divided by ten.

We have 0.55 hectometers. Express that value in decimeters!

From hectometers to decimeters, it goes down 3 times. So,

0.55 hectometers = 0.55 × 10 × 10 × 10 decimeters

0.55 hectometers = 0.55 × 1000 decimeters

0.55 hectometers = 550 decimeters

Hence, 0.55 hectometers is equal to 550 decimeters.
